§ 16-60-23 — Incorporation of College

Alabama·Title 16 Education·Ch. 60 Trade Schools and Junior Colleges·Art. 2 Junior College for Franklin, Marion and Winston Counties
When a location for the college has been determined and the board has chosen a name for the college, the board of trustees shall file in the office of the Secretary of State a certificate stating the name and location of the college and the names of persons currently serving as members of the board of trustees. Thereafter, the college shall be a body corporate under the name so filed, with the right to have and use a corporate seal, to sue and be sued in such corporate name in any of the courts of this state of competent jurisdiction as in the case of natural persons.
